Transaction 66a65a02ecd1411fbea8de30fd0da2725ec812ef89a76e00aeffcd0cfcee16c8

1 Input
2 Outputs
  • 66a65a02ecd1411fbea8de30fd0da2725ec812ef89a76e00aeffcd0cfcee16c8:0
  • value  13907175
    address  32SzB2t7iVJReMYaGY9fGN5ZiMBNW3acnW
  • 66a65a02ecd1411fbea8de30fd0da2725ec812ef89a76e00aeffcd0cfcee16c8:1
  • value  30000000
    address  1CBpF5WkpTf48HrMwzeK2sCtXqxe5gvXsh